I just was watching the news and noticed that people with Parkinson's Disease were being told to start dancing as when they dance they often have a break from their symptoms and feel "normal." The experts do not know whether this ability to move freely and to feel the feelings in the body that have not been felt for some time is due to the endorphins or happy chemicals that it causes or something else. Add this to the research that shows that those who take up dancing tend to exercise more and to enjoy doing it and thus tend to lose more weight and be happier doing it than those who take up other forms of exercise and it looks like dancing is a very healthy way to have fun.
